Injury Woes for Washington Commanders Ahead of Giants Showdown

The Washington Commanders find themselves in a challenging position as they prepare to face the New York Giants in Week 15, aiming to end an eight-game losing streak. Unfortunately, the team’s hopes of a turnaround are dampened by a series of injuries that have plagued their roster throughout the season.

Quarterback Situation

Quarterback Jayden Daniels, who has struggled with an elbow injury, has officially been ruled out yet again. Daniels re-aggravated his condition last week during a matchup against the Minnesota Vikings, leading to Marcus Mariota stepping in as the starting quarterback for the seventh time this season. Mariota is expected to lead the Commanders for the remainder of the year, taking on the critical role of guiding the offense through this challenging stretch.

Defensive Setbacks

The Commanders’ defense also faces significant challenges with the absence of cornerback Jonathan Jones, who is sidelined due to a rib injury. His experience and playmaking ability will be missed as the team looks to contain the Giants’ offense.

Backfield Challenges

In the backfield, running back Chris Rodriguez Jr. joins the ranks of the injured, dealing with a groin issue that will keep him out of the game against New York. In his absence, Jacory Croskey-Merritt and Jeremy McNichols will be tasked with carrying the rushing workload, adding pressure on the pair to step up in a crucial game.

Offensive Line Concerns

The Commanders are also feeling the impact along their offensive line. Trent Scott has been designated as a healthy scratch, while George Fant continues to struggle with a knee injury and will not participate against the Giants. These offensive line issues could further hinder the team’s ability to protect Mariota and establish a running game.

Defensive Line Adjustments

Adding to the Commanders’ injury list is defensive end Drake Jackson, who is coping with both groin and knee injuries, rendering him unavailable for this critical matchup. His absence will place additional strain on the defensive unit as they prepare to face a Giants team looking to capitalize on any weaknesses.

As the Commanders gear up for this vital clash, the stakes are high, and the pressure is mounting. The upcoming game promises to be a test of resilience for the team, navigating not only their losing streak but also the challenges posed by their injury-riddled roster.
